    Pinky J.

    A few of us was recommended Mission BBQ since we wanted something different. This spot is located on Rockville Pike near other restaurants and has a private parking lot with lots of spaces. After looking over the menu which has plenty of options, we placed our order online which was fairly easy. GRILLED SHRIMP ($13.84) The size is just as i wished and grilled to perfection, this was sooooo good esp with the BBQ sauce. I'm glad they have seafood options instead of just meats. SALMON ($15) They give a decent size and it was cooked well, I just wished it was grilled like the shrimp. It have more baked that grilled in my opinion. If this had char marks with extra smoky flavor, it would be perfect for me plus with the BBQ sauce, chefs kiss. MAC N CHEESE ($3.39) Sadly, I was disappointed in the mac n cheese, it wasn't flavorful nor cheesy in how I expected. The presentation was beautiful but the taste didn't match expectations. Maybe using a different cheeses and/or sauce base and adding more seasoning might help. CORN ON THE COB & DRINK DEAL ($5.75) I haven't had corn in forever but this was good esp being grilled and buttery. I got 1/2 tea 1/2 lemonade and BABYYYYY this was perfect!!! This drink alone needed to be in a gallon container bc the way I wanted more was insane lol. CORNBREAD (FREE) It was a cute size, definitely perfect for the meal but if you can eat it all, you must have a big appetite because the food was beyond filing. I wish it came with butter and a honey drizzle. BBQ SAUCES (VARIETY) I love the sauces but my favorite is the HONEY HEAT, spicy with a touch of sweetness. I like how they give you as much as needed and perfect for finding what's fits your tastebuds. Customer Service was nice and accommodating especially after messing up part of our order. It was greatly appreciated for them to fix their mistake which is recognized. I wished they had better meal deals/pricing and some improvement on some sides/food. Overall, I'm glad to try this spot.

    Jeff B.

    Came for lunch today. I got the 2-item platter with two sides, as did my partner. Between the two of us, we got moist brisket, ribs and classic sausage. For sides, we got cole slaw, potato salad and baked beans. Each platter comes with a cornbread. Ok, so here goes. The sausage and ribs were delicious. The sides were delicious. The corn bread was delicious. And the moist brisket was . . . Brisket. It wasn't particularly moist and it tasted like what I would get if I bought a brisket at the grocery store and cooked it myself. It tasted like a piece of brisket. No smokiness, no sense of it being cooked for hours with any particular style or care. It's really disappointing. Like, I'm not getting that again. I watched as the kitchen sliced it and I could tell while watching that it was not particularly moist. The people working there were friendly and came by a couple of times to see how we were doing and to clear off the table when one of us was done. There are six sauces available and each is different, with varying degrees of spiciness and sweetness. Of the six, I preferred the Memphis Belle, Smoky Mountain and Tupelo Honey Heat. The sauces remind me of one other thing. To me (I lived 7 years in Texas outside of Houston), moist brisket should be outstanding on its own and shouldn't need sauce. But this brisket, being neither particularly moist (we both asked for moist) or unique, benefited from a liberal use of sauce. Unfortunately. I'd like to give the place a 3.5 because the brisket is so disappointing, but am rounding up for the friendly staff, the sausage and ribs were good, and the availability of 6 interesting and tasty bbq sauces.
